Description
Nuvista Light and Electric Cooperative achieves its mission by undertaking energy-focused initiatives such as regional and community energy planning, feasibility studies, energy education, and energy infrastructure projects while collaborating with non-profit and Tribal groups. In addition, it participates in the BIA program that provides business development and capacity development in Kwethluk to prepare the community for wind and battery projects. Its location is Anchorage, AK.

Program areas at Nuvista Light and Electric Cooperative

Regional Energy Plan/USDA - A major program in 2022 included development of a wind project in the YK Delta. The project will involve installing wind generation and energy storage in Kwethluk, Alaska. The intent of the project is to decrease energy costs for the community, decrease dependence on fossil fuels, increase resilience, and off-set diesel consumption.
BIA - This program is supplementary to the Regional Energy Plan and USDA programs. The BIA program covers business development and capacity development in Kwethluk to ensure the community is prepared to take on the wind and battery project when it is commissioned. Nuvista and sub-contractors worked with Kwethluk Incorporated on a power purchase agreement, clean energy business plan, and operations and maintenance planning.
Doe - Nuvista launched a grant-funded effort to bolster the wind project in kwethluk by purchasing a battery energy storage system that will be installed in the power plant. The purpose of the battery is to improve the economics of the kwethluk wind project, provide improved energy resilience in the event of power outages, and reduce consumption of fossil fuels.
